Greenplum database tutorial pdf

Emc greenplum introduces free community edition of big data tools for developers and data scientists industrywide data collaboration and innovation is enabled by free emc greenplum database edition, open source analytic algorithms from madlib, and alpine miner visual modeler. Pdf data warehousing with greenplum data warehousing with. Connecting to a greenplum database from informatica using ssl. Greenplum database stores and processes large amounts of data by distributing the data and processing workload across several servers or hosts. We developed the postgresql tutorial to demonstrate the unique features of postgresql that make it the most advanced opensource database management system.

From processing structured and unstructured data to presenting the resultsinsights to key business stakeholders, this book explains it all. Learn the fundamentals of greenplum database for beginners in this hour plus long short course. Greenplum was founded in september 2003 by luke lonergan and scott yara. Information about configuring, managing and monitoring greenplum database installations, and administering, monitoring, and working with databases. What is good and bad about the greenplum, compared to oracle and greenplum. Greenplum database administrator guide pivotal greenplum docs.

It provides powerful and rapid analytics on petabyte scale da. Students will learn the essential skills required to use the greenplum database system. There are a number of ways to keep uptodate with the latest news and knowledge related to greenplum. The tutorial assumes that youre using a unixlike system and docker. Gpdb is an advanced, fully featured, open source data warehouse. For a complete list of data connections, select more under to a server. The problem data growth and other recent trends in dwh a look at different customers and their requirements the solution teaching an old dog new tricks. Learn to design, deploy, and administer greenplum database systems for big data analysis. The master is the entry point to the greenplum database system. The only open source, massively parallel, cloud and onpremise data warehouse. Let me help you out with the greenplum since i kicked off my career with greenplum some 3. An introduction and tutorial using the greenplum database sandbox vm. Contribute to greenplumdbgpdbsandboxtutorials development by creating an account on.

Greenplum database endusers interact with greenplum database through the master as they would with a typical postgresql database. You must explicitly configure greenplum database to permit access from all spark nodes and standalone clients. To use the create database command, you must be connected to a database. By automatically partitioning data and running parallel queries, it allows a cluster of servers to operate as a single database supercomputer performing tens or hundreds times. Greenplum database configuration and maintenance pivotal. Greenplum architecture greenplumdbgpdb wiki github.

Start tableau and under connect, select pivotal greenplum database. The company became part of the pivotal software in 2012. Its assumed that you will have some experience with database design and programming as well as be familiar with analytics tools like r and weka. It is designed to be used with the greenplum database sandbox vm that is available for download from the pivotal network. Greenplum database administrator guide pivotal greenplum.

Learn about the latest developments of the greenplum database. Getting started with greenplum for big data analytics pdf. Bireme is an incremental synchronization tool for the greenplum hashdata data warehouse. Getting started with greenplum for big data analytics is a practical, handson guide to learning and implementing big data analytics using the greenplum integrated analytics platform. The company releases the database management system software based on postgresql in 2005. What are major differences between oracle and greenplum. Learn about the capabilities and community forming around the newly open source greenplum database gpdb.

Running analytics directly in greenplum database, rather than exporting data to a separate analytics engine, allows greater agility when exploring large data sets and much better performance due to parallelizing the analytic processes across all the segments. This documentation describes how to install, configure, and use pivotal greenplum database, and provides links to related pivotal products that work with. The only open source, massively parallel, cloud and onpremise data. Highlevel overview of the greenplum database system architecture. Extend sql with graph analytics and machine learning greenplum supports apache madlib, an opensource library of distributed, in database. A variety of power analytic tools is available for use with greenplum database. Emc greenplum introduces free community edition of big. In python, we have serval modules available to connect and work with postgresql. Greenplum workload manager tutorial by greenplum database. Users connect to greenplum database through the master using a postgresqlcompatible client program such as psql or odbc the master maintains the system catalog a set of system tables that contain metadata. Please use the link provided below to generate a unique link valid for 24hrs. You can configure secure communication between the gpload utility and the greenplum server. Greenplum architecture, administration, and implementation.

These tutorials showcase how gpdb can address daytoday tasks performed in typical dwbi environments. Connecting to a greenplum database from informatica using. Connecting to a greenplum database database migration. These greenplum database configuration and maintenance tasks, described below, must be performed by a greenplum user with administrative superuser privileges unless otherwise noted. Pivotal greenplum administrator training vmware tanzu. The new database is a copy of the template1 database, unless you specify a different template. Greenplum database stores and processes large amounts of data by distributing the load across several servers or hosts. These vms contain the commercially supported versions of greenplum database and greenplum command center. Explore, download, and update software and services.

How to download getting started with greenplum for big data analytics pdf. Postgresql tutorial postgresql is a powerful, open source objectrelational database system. The company is acquired by emc in 2010, and its database management system is known as pivotal greenplum database. Python postgresql tutorial using psycopg2 complete guide. Madlib, an opensource, mpp implementation read more. If you dont know anything about greenplum, i recommend you to register with official pivotal site pivotal academy there you can find the intrd. The guide also contains information about greenplum database.

Administrators need to rotate the log files periodically so that new log files are started and old ones are removed after a reasonable period of time. About the greenplum architecture pivotal greenplum docs. Chapter 3, getting started with greenplum database an introduction to greenplum database in a handson tutorial format. The docbook sgml source for the manuals is available as part of the postgresql source download available in. Click on the new icon in the project panel at the top left corner of the window.

The guide also contains information about greenplum database architecture and concepts such as parallel processing. The greenplum database master is the entry to the greenplum database system, accepting client connections and sql queries, and distributing work to the segment instances. It is the database server process that accepts client connections and processes the sql commands that system users issue. Regardless of your experience with greenplum, here are some tools and links to help you better understand how to get the most out of your greenplum database. Greenplum database tools, utilities, and internals.

A logical database in greenplum is an array of individual postgresql databases working together to present a single database image. Introduction to the greenplum database architecture. Pivotal greenplum database is a massively parallel processing mpp database server that supports next generation data warehousing and largescale analytics processing. These tutorials showcase how greenplum database can address daytoday tasks performed in typical dw, bi and data science environments. Parallel programming on data for advanced analytics.

This updated edition teaches you best practices for greenplum database, the open source massively parallel processing mpp database for analyzing integrated relational and nonrelational data at enterprise scale. The bottom line is that the greenplum database is capable of win. It has more than 15 years of active development and a proven architecture that has earn. Greenplum database, mixed local data and remote hdfs data as a single table by scott kahler. Chapter 2, installing a singlen ode greenplum database instance instructions for installing and intializing a singlenode greenplum database instance. The scriptsdata for this tutorial are in the gpdbsandbox virtual machine at homegpadmin. This python postgresql tutorial demonstrates how to develop python database applications with the postgresql database server. How can sqlbased systems evolve to meet the scale and diversity of modern data. Pivotal greenplum administrator training this course provides administrators with the necessary background to install and maintain the greenplum database. Connecting to a greenplum database using ssl overview when you create a greenplum connection, the gpload utility uses the configured attributes to connect to the greenplum database.

Greenplum database log output tends to be voluminous especially at higher debug levels and you do not need to save it indefinitely. These greenplum database configuration and maintenance tasks, described below, must be performed by a greenplum user with administrative superuser privileges. By embedding machine learning in an mpp platform, pivotal greenplum can help analysts and data scientists run more models in less time. Heres a link to greenplum database s open source repository on github. Use the following procedure to connect to your greenplum database. What are the best resources to learn greenplum database and.

Select greenplum in the platform dropdown list at the top of the dialog box. Getting started with greenplum for big data analytics. Enter the name of the server that hosts the database and the name of the database you want. What are the best resources to learn greenplum database. Create a new database with the create database sql command in psql or the createdb utility command in a terminal.

First, you will learn how to query data from a single table using basic data selection techniques such as selecting columns, sorting result sets, and filtering rows. What you need to know release notes download ask for help knowledge base pdf. Let me help you out with the greenplum since i kicked off my career with. Greenplum database is an array of individual databases based upon postgresql 8.

145 336 931 1306 1352 58 1079 1005 819 1634 1096 568 524 1126 701 630 1429 1015 1057 264 1488 1518 561 1285 1208 1325 143 1489 1019 1331 1198 1401 272 847 1360 1202 539